In this project, CSULB will develop a series of case studies designed to evaluate the impacts of freight-related environmental policies. The team will then produce brief videos to accompany the case studies research, in order to reach a wider audience.
The CSULB Center for International Trade and Transportation (CITT) will write a white paper on introducing GIS technology to high school students. CITT will then develop the introductory GIS workshop for high school students with a focus on sustainable transportation.

This project will result in a white paper that presents the workforce challenges faced by transit agencies as they transition their fleets to zero emission vehicle technologies, and will suggest training strategies to help bridge these challenges.
